Your Role:
Purpose of the Role
The Manager MAP develops the local market access and pricing strategic and operational plans. The role ensures high quality payer submission dossiers and a strong negotiation strategy, value materials (and payer mapping as needed).
Develops MAP strategies and operational plans, and ensures implementation in close coordination with franchises.
MAP input into Country Brand Strategies and Brand Planning.
Full MAP strategy for key brands with implementation plans.
Key member of country product teams.
Develops payer negotiation strategy and payer mapping, targeting and segmentation as needed, tailoring all necessary supporting evidence.
Develops all payer value materials for national and sub-national institutional payers, including submission dossiers, tailored payer brochures with value messages, localized c/e and budget impact models, etc.
Delivers or arranges training and capability development of MAP staff.
Stays up-to-date on current and upcoming pricing and reimbursement regulations.
